Diego Dalla Palma- Snow White & The Huntsman Palette

Mirror, Mirror On The Wall... Who's The Fairest Of Them All?

When I read the press release I just had to blog about the amazing palette which Diego Dalla Palma has designed to replicate the battleground adventure from the film Snow White & the Huntsman. If you haven't seen the official trailer for this movie you need to check it out, this looks amazing. Universal Films selected Diego Dalla Palma as the official cosmetic partner. From looking at the image below I would say Diego Dalla Palma did a great job!

 

The palette comes packaged within a very sturdy looking box, once inside you have an oval mirror which is very ironic don't you think? The palette consists of 6 shades, 3 of which have a shimmer finish whilst the other three are matte. This palette would be welcomed with open arms to any 'Nude/Natural' fanatic, myself included-but wait that's not all. You also have a full sized lipstick called The Wicked Queen Lipstick in a vivid blood red and an eye pencil called Dark night. Overall I would say the palette is certainly worth the RRP £25, however I just think they would've done something more elaborate inside the box, something shiny or sparkly. Maybe a 3d apple of something, just to put it up there next to the Urban Decay palettes.

NEW CID Cosmetics - i-Colour

NEW CID Cosmetics are launching a new cream eye shadow, I've been wearing cream eye shadows recently and so when the New CID Cosmetics i-Colour  landed on my doorstep I couldn't wait to swatch it and wear it. I've enjoyed wearing this on my lids on its own with lovely long lashes, then focusing on flushed cheeks and glossy lips.


The texture is amazing and not at all like your Cadbury's chocolate mousse lol, when you touch it with your finger tip it feels very creamy and almost 'spongy.Very easy to apply and blend, I think the shades would work really well together. i-Colour is waterproof and has serious staying power which is always on the top of my list when applying eye shadows.The shade I have is Crystal Quartz which is a beautiful gold shimmery metallic, there's another seven shades to pick from.The shades are beautiful and very versatile, from vibrant blues to smokey charcoal and soft pink.Crystal Quartz is easily worn for every day but would also be an amazing base if you wanted to wear metallic shades over the top. Xen-Tan Perfect Bronze

Following on from my Xen-Tan review featuring the Deep Bronze Luxe Lotion  I have the Perfect Bronze compact to show you today. I've still been keeping up with my self- tan routine and love the results, I've not needed to wear foundation some days and so the Perfect Bronze has been the only face product which I've needed.



I use my e.l.f stipple brush to apply and buff into my skin, the colour in the pan looks scary but believe me this looks stunning over a tanned face. It evens out my tan and gives such a healthy bronzed glow.

 

This is shimmer-free which is perfect for day time and even a little contouring, Xen Tan say it has a natural Olive undertone which basically means you shouldn't look like you've been tango-ed.


You can purchase Perfect Bronze online here from the Xen-Ten web site, RRP £21.99 12g.

Clarins - Crystal Lip Balm Crystal Coral

With Summer fast approaching I've been enjoying summer makeup looks. Bronzed skin with a touch of highlight, blue/bronze eyes with long lashes and glossy lips! I've been reaching for Clarins Crystal Lip balms. I love the silver sleek packaging and the coloured base which is great for when you're looking for a particular shade. Today I wanted to show you Crystal -Coral, perfect for the Summer!

 

I wanted to blog about Clarins Crystal Lip Balms. These are amazing, these came out with the Summer collection last year. They provide lips with a protective barrier, whilst hydrating them then giving them a luscious full plump lip. They look and apply like a lipstick, they treat your lips like a balm and they look like a subtle gloss on the lips. These are set to make a come back with this years Summer collection, so if you missed out last year don't miss out again!

 


My lips are naturally quite pink so this shade intensifies them and giving them a rich coral finish, I think this shade is my favourite out of the 3. It looks amazing with a tan and some bronzer!

Purple Eyes & Glossy Lips!

Purple isn't often a colour I use on my eyes but every once in a while it's nice to try something different don't you think? GOSH have recently launched these really nice Smokey Eye palettes, today I'm wearing 03 Plum.


The shadows feel soft and velvety upon the first touch, my favourite 2 shades are the middle two but then I suppose that's no surprise ha ha! These compacts are perfect to travel with because you can use the lighter shades for the day and then totally change your look for the evening by using the darker shades to add more definition. There's also a handy film which lays over the top of the shadows, showing you where to place the shadows if you're unsure.  



Flower Rose Powder blush is a very soft rosy pink/red blush which brightens up the face instantly! You only need a small amount because of the great pigmentation, that's one thing which you can say about Gosh Cosmetics, the quality of the products are always reliable.


I used Gosh Velvet Touch Pink Darling Waterproof eye liner in the waterline to brighten the eyes, I would love to try more of the other shades of the eye liners. These are so soft and remind me of MAC's actually.
